Abstract

The present invention provides a closed smoking tool that belongs to the field of everyday items and aims to solve problems such as the difficulty of cleaning up ashes when smoking, the impact of smoke on others, and environmental pollution caused by cigarette butts. [Solution] The tool comprises a tool body, which houses a sealed combustion chamber 3, an ash collection box 6, a smoke filter 11, an ignition device 4, an electric suction port 8, a battery 7, and a smoke storage chamber 9. A smoking nozzle 10 is provided on the exterior, and the smoking nozzle is connected to the smoke storage chamber. The sealed combustion chamber is connected to the smoke filter via an air intake 2, which is in turn connected to the electric suction port and the smoke storage chamber. The ash collection box is provided at the bottom of the tool body and is connected to the sealed combustion chamber via an ash discharge port 5. The smoking nozzle remains closed when not in use. The advantages of this device are as follows: The sealed combustion chamber prevents smoke from being exposed to the outside, reducing its impact on the surrounding area. The smoke filter eliminates the need for conventional filters and reduces the generation of cigarette butts. The ash collection box allows for centralized collection and disposal of ash, making cleaning easy and highly practical.

[0009] Referring to FIG. 1, a specific implementation of the present invention will be described in detail. In this closed-type smoking tool, the closed combustion chamber (3) communicates with the ash collection box (6) via the ash outlet (5), and at the same time, the closed combustion chamber (3) is connected to the smoke filter (11) via the air inlet (2). One end of the smoke filter (11) remote from the air inlet (2) is connected to the powered suction port (8), which in turn communicates with the smoke storage chamber (9). The other end of the smoke storage chamber (9) remote from the powered suction port (8) is connected to the smoking nozzle (10). A battery (7) supplies power to the ignition device (4) and the powered suction port (8), and a tobacco insertion port (1) is located at the top of the closed combustion chamber (3) and is used to insert a tobacco.

[0010] The usage procedure is as follows: The cover of the cigarette insertion port (1) is opened, a cigarette is placed in the closed combustion chamber (3), and the cover is closed. The ignition device (4) is activated to light the tobacco in the closed combustion chamber (3). The smoke generated by the burning of the tobacco is guided from the intake port (2) to the smoke filter (11) by the suction action of the electric suction port (8), filtered by the smoke filter (11), and then temporarily stored in the smoke storage chamber (9) through the electric suction port (8). Ash generated by burning cigarettes falls through the ash outlet (5) into the ash collection box (6) and is collected therein. The user inhales the smoke in the smoke chamber 9 by drawing air through the smoking nozzle 10. After smoking is finished, the smoking nozzle 10 automatically returns to its closed state.
